The Gil Hibben IV Machete Knife with Leather Sheath is a stunning blend of functionality and artistry, crafted by the legendary knife maker Gil Hibben. Originally designed for a hit motion picture and featured on the cover of Blade magazine, this machete is more than just a tool—it's a piece of cinematic and knife-making history. Forged from a single piece of 1090 carbon steel, the machete features a weathered finish that highlights its rugged aesthetic, ensuring unparalleled strength and durability for any challenge. Its ergonomic black cord-wrapped handle provides a secure and comfortable grip, whether you're cutting through dense brush or showcasing it in your collection. The 18 1/4" machete is paired with a premium leather lanyard and a heavy-duty leather sheath, making it practical for outdoor adventures and easy to transport. Complete with a certificate of authenticity, the Gil Hibben IV Machete Knife is a must-have for enthusiasts, collectors, and outdoor adventurers.
